After a previous patch applied...
Bug: a line number declaration (# NUM xxx "file_name") is not used
when generating a debug info. A test case: precompile your project
files with tcc and then use a precompiled files to get an executable
with a debug info included. This info will be wrong. A gcc works rigth
in this case.

> Return back a grischka patch which lost after
> "Split elf_output_file in smaller functions"
>
> Author: grischka <grischka>
> Date: Tue Feb 5 21:18:29 2013 +0100
> tccelf: fix debug section relocation
> With:
> tcc -g hello.c
> gdb a.out
> b main
> gdb refused to know "main" because of broken dwarf info.
